PEOPLE v. MILLER

No. E049206.

187 Cal.App.4th 902 (2010)

114 Cal. Rptr. 3d 629

THE PEOPLE, Plaintiff and Appellant, v. EDWARD LORENZO MILLER, JR., Defendant and Respondent.

Court of Appeals of California, Fourth District, Division Two.

August 20, 2010.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Rod Pacheco, District Attorney, Alan D. Tate and Kelli Catlett, Deputy District Attorneys, for Plaintiff and Appellant.

Barbara A. Smith, under appointment by the Court of Appeal, for Defendant and Respondent.


OPINION

RAMIREZ, P. J.—

A jury convicted Edward Lorenzo Miller, Jr., defendant, of sexual penetration of a minor (Pen. Code, § 288.7, subd. (b)).1 Defendant's motion for a new trial was granted by the trial court.
